I know everyone has been freaking out about the return of Starbucks Pumpkin Spice Latte, but this is the time of year when I really enjoy a good nonfat Chai Latte (pumpkin fans better get up off me!) Chai is a blend of black tea (so it has some health benefits AND caffeine), and Indian herbs and spices; like cinnamon, cardamom, ginger, etc...  Did you know that cinnamon can lower your blood sugar levels, and treat muscle spasms, vomiting, diarrhea, infections, the common cold, and loss of appetite. Cardamom can help with mouth ulcers, digestive problems, and even depression.  And ginger can help with gastrointestinal relief, anti-inflammatory effects, protection against colorectal & ovarian cancer, and help boost your immune system.  I have NONE of the above, however I have convinced myself that this drink is a necessary preventative for my well-being! But in all honestly the smell of the spices is what makes me feel warm and happy, happy, happy inside.  Mmmmm...
